US Fish and Wildlife Service Developer Salary

The average US Fish and Wildlife Service Developer earns an estimated $101,193 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$91,526 with a $9,667 bonus. US Fish and Wildlife Service's Developer compensation is $6,022 less than the US average for a Developer. Developer salaries at US Fish and Wildlife Service can range from $79,000 - $113,000.

The Engineering Department at US Fish and Wildlife Service earns $1,307 more on average than the HR Department.
